Kosovo Prime Minister Ramush Haradinaj, at a closing conference of the year, has again talked about the tax imposed on Serbian products.
He has been determined that Kosovo does not remove the tax unless Serbia changes its approach to Kosovo.
“If Serbia does not change and if it is the same one that presents a mini-Russia in the Balkans, the tax will remain forever, eternally. But if a mutual recognition agreement is made, the tax will be lifted”.
He said we have given millions to Serbia to buy weapons in Russia.
“is 20 years old and Serbia is still a mini-Russia in the Balkans. She's not European. When can we pull? As soon as the deal comes, we take it off. The tax is not only mine is the coalition agreement. My hand doesn't remove the tax under these”.
Haradinaj said that the goods he entered before the verdict would not be subject to this, because it would be damaging to all who bought it.
